Product Information
Ibuprofen belongs to a group of medicines known as non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s). NSAIDs provides relief by changing the body's response to pain, swelling, and high temperature.
Usage
Ibuprofen is only for short term use. Do not take Ibuprofen for longer than 10 days. The lowest effective dose should be used for the shortest duration necessary to relieve symptoms. If you have an infection, consult with a doctor without delay if symptoms (such as fever and pain) persist or worsen.
Dosage in adults, the elderly and children over 12 years - Take 1 or 2 tablets every 4-8 hours. Do not take more than 6 tablets in 24 hours.
Take the tablet with food and swallow whole with a drink of water.
Do not give these tablets to children under 12 years old except on the advice of a doctor.
If in adolescents this product is required for more than 3 days of if symptoms worsen a doctor should be consulted.
Ingredients
Active ingredient: Each tablet contains 200mg of ibuprofen. See enclosed leaflet for full ingredients list.
Suitable For
Suitable for adults and children over the age of 12.
Cautions/Allergies
Do not take if you: have (or have had two or more episodes of) a stomach ulcer, perforation or bleeding, are allergic to ibuprofen, to any of the ingredients, or to aspirin or other painkillers, are taking other NSAID pain killers or aspirin with a daily dose of 75mg. Speak to a pharmacist/doctor before taking if you: have or have had asthma, diabetes, high cholesterol, high blood pressure, a stroke, heart, liver, kidney or bowel problems, are a smoker, are pregnant. Do not exceed the stated dose. Keep out of the reach and sight of children.
